Does the divorce of prohibition take effect if it was merely a thought or a doubt in its wording, and does it take effect if one went to the street out of necessity then roamed in it with the intention of flirting?

1 min readAlso available in العربية

As long as you are not certain that you uttered the oath, then no divorce, prohibition, or expiation for breaking an oath results from it. This is because divorce and prohibition do not occur merely by intention without utterance. Indulging in whispers (waswas) leads to evil and tribulation, and ignoring them is the best remedy.
